Alice and Bob have 2n + 1 coins, each coin with probability of heads equal to 1/2. Bob tosses n+ 1 coins, while Alice tosses the remaining n coins. Assuming independent coin tosses, show that the probability that after all coins have been tossed, Bob will have gotten more heads than Alice is 1/2.
